Output 74eba94290c9bbe12a9ce6aeff0bf53dc16bfd4f578d6992289f65f5d2dae799:1

value
1098423
script pubkey
OP_0 OP_PUSHBYTES_20 b66977ce8e588e81719b1bc107a50bf38d64e629
address
bc1qke5h0n5wtz8gzuvmr0qs0fgt7wxkfe3f3s8w54
transaction
74eba94290c9bbe12a9ce6aeff0bf53dc16bfd4f578d6992289f65f5d2dae799
confirmations
203653
spent
true